Quarterly Planning Note — Insurance Renewal

Sales leads: our commercial liability policy with Hallowmere Assurance renews at quarter-end. Premiums are expected to rise roughly 12% given last year's claims at the Fenwick Depot. Finance is obtaining competing quotes, and coverage terms for the Orvex product line are under review. Please flag any client commitments affected. The confidential planning note appears below.

board note of fahif-yahog: Gross margin on Wenath came in at 10 percent against a plan of 5 percent. Only 3 of the 100 pilot accounts renewed Wenath, so a churn review is set for July 15.

- [ ] **Step 7: Breaker override escrow.** After sealing the signing keys for the Tallgrove upstream API circuit breaker, confirm the support team can force the breaker open during a full outage. The override bundle lives in the sealed escrow drawer and is useless without its unlock phrase. Two ceremony witnesses must initial this step before proceeding. The escrow bundle is decrypted with the recovery passphrase that follows.

vault phrase of kahip-kahop = holath-quenmir

TURN-208: Gatevale turnstile counters at the Merrow Field pilot double-count when a rotation reverses mid-cycle. Attendance totals drift roughly 2% high per event. The debounce window fix is implemented, reviewed by Ilsa, and soak-tested across two simulated match days without drift. Ready for your cut; the candidate build is identified below.

trace token, tagag-tafog: htk6_5ed18c